The Lumi 23.3 m2 Timber Conservatory with Sliding Doors is a spacious and contemporary garden building designed to create a bright and versatile extra living area. With its clean lines, generous glazed sections and modern timber design, it offers a stylish way to extend your usable space outdoors, whether as a garden lounge, dining area, entertaining space or relaxing retreat.

Its large footprint provides plenty of room to furnish the interior in a way that suits your lifestyle, making it ideal for both everyday use and special occasions. The sliding doors help create an open connection to the garden, allowing the space to feel light, airy and easy to enjoy throughout the warmer months. The extensive glazing also helps draw in natural light, giving the conservatory a welcoming and open feel.

With a wall height of 230cm and a total height of 276cm, the Lumi offers a comfortable sense of space inside. Its proportions make it well suited to larger patios, decking areas and landscaped gardens, where it can act as both a practical outdoor room and an attractive architectural feature. The rectangular layout is especially useful for creating clearly defined seating, dining or multi-purpose zones within the same space.

Built with 19mm roof boards and solid 120mm x 120mm posts, this conservatory combines modern style with a sturdy structure. The result is a practical and attractive garden building that brings together space, light and flexibility in one smart design. This building can be used as a sunroom, sunroom extension or as a conservatory.

Maintenance chevron-up chevron-down

Wood is a natural material, growing and adapting depending on weather conditions. Large and small cracks, colour tone differences and changes, as well as a changing structure of wood are not errors, but a result of wood growing and a peculiarity of wood as a natural material.

Unprocessed wood (except for foundation joists) becomes greyish after having been left untouched for a while and can be turn blue and become mouldy.

To protect the wooden details of your garden building, you must immediately protect them with a wood preservative. We recommend that you cover the floorboards in advance with a colourless wood impregnation agent, especially the bottom sides of the boards, to which you will no longer have access when the house is assembled. Only this will prevent moisture penetration.

It is also important to protect the doors and windows with a wood impregnation agent, both inside and outside! Otherwise, the doors and windows can become twisted/warped.

After the building assembly is completed, we recommend finishing with a weather protection paint that will protect wood from moisture and UV radiation.

When painting, use high quality tools and paints, follow the paint application manual and manufacturer’s safety and usage instructions. Never paint a surface in strong sunlight or rainy weather.

Consult a specialist regarding paints suitable for unprocessed softwood and follow the paint manufacturer’s instructions.

Having been properly painted, your garden buildings lifetime will increase substantially. We recommend that you inspect the house thoroughly once every six months.
